Textile
Tunic Sleeve Drape
E16913
From: Egypt
Curatorial Section: Egyptian
Object Number | E16913 |
Current Location | Collections Storage |
Culture | Meroitic |
Provenience | Egypt |
Date Made | 100 BCE-300 CE |
Section | Egyptian |
Materials | Linen | Wool |
Technique | Tapestry Weave |
Description | Tan. Wool. Double panels of tapestry-woven design. These in purple wool with the design of ecru linen thread. |
Length | 17 cm |
Width | 41.5 cm |
Credit Line | Distribution from the Egyptian Research Account; William Flinders Petrie; subscription of Mrs. John Harrison, 1895 |
